I don’t want a role out of sympathy – Shwetha Basu

Published on Tuesday, 04 November 2014 12:45 PM


Shweta Basu Prasad, who was recently caught in a prostitution racket in Hyderabad has been released from the rescue home. A while ago, it was reported that many directors were ready to offer her roles in their films.

Speaking to a leading portal, this young actress stated that, she does not want a role out of sympathy and instead, would like to audition for any role that has been offered to her. She also added that one ugly incident would never change her life and she would fight back more strongly in the future.
